The Indian Financial System Code, popularly known as IFSC, is an 11-digit alphanumeric code that the RBI assigns to every bank branch participating in online interbank settlement. Without this code, an electronic transfer simply cannot reach its destination branch.
The IFSC for The Kangra Central Cooperative Bank Limited – KASBA KOTLA is KACE0000127. The first four letters KACE are the bank's identifier, the fifth digit is reserved as 0, and the trailing six characters 000127 map to this branch in KASBA KOTLA, HIMACHAL PRADESH.

Branch details at a glance
| Bank Name | The Kangra Central Cooperative Bank Limited |
|---|---|
| Branch | Kasba Kotla |
| IFSC Code | KACE0000127 |
| MICR Code | Refer to cheque leaf |
| Branch Address | VPO KASBA KOTLA TEHSIL JASWAN DISTT. KANGRA H.P. 177111 |
| City | Kasba Kotla |
| District | Kangra |
| State | Himachal Pradesh |
| STD Code | 1970 |
| Phone | 253809 |

Why every The Kangra Central Cooperative Bank Limited branch has a unique IFSC
Before electronic settlement systems went live in India, money transfers between banks relied heavily on demand drafts, mail transfers and telegraphic transfers. These older instruments routinely took days to clear and were prone to misrouting because there was no single machine-readable identifier for a branch. The Reserve Bank of India solved this by issuing each participating branch — including KASBA KOTLA of The Kangra Central Cooperative Bank Limited — its own 11-character IFSC. The code KACE0000127 is therefore not just an internal reference; it is the digital postcode that lets the RBI's NEFT, RTGS and IMPS rails route funds straight to the right branch ledger without any human intervention.
Today, almost every salary credit, vendor payment, refund and EMI deduction in the country flows through this network, which is exactly why a correct IFSC matters so much. A wrong character can either bounce the transfer or send it to the wrong branch, and reversing such a credit is a manual, time-consuming process. NEFT vs RTGS vs IMPS — which one should you use?
All three modes accept the IFSC KACE0000127 for The Kangra Central Cooperative Bank Limited – KASBA KOTLA, but they differ in speed, minimum amount and use case. The table below summarises the differences so you can pick the right channel for the situation at hand.
| Parameter | NEFT | RTGS | IMPS |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minimum amount | ₹1 | ₹2,00,000 | ₹1 |
| Maximum amount | No RBI cap | No RBI cap | ₹5,00,000 |
| Settlement | Half-hourly batches | Real-time | Real-time |
| Availability | 24x7 | 24x7 | 24x7 |
| Best for | Routine transfers | High-value transfers | Urgent small / mid transfers |
| IFSC required | Yes – KACE0000127 | Yes – KACE0000127 | Yes – KACE0000127 |
For most retail customers crediting the Kasba Kotla branch, NEFT or IMPS will be the quickest and most economical option. RTGS comes in for one-off, high-value movements such as property purchases, vendor settlements or large gifts.

What is the difference between IFSC and MICR code?
IFSC is an 11-character alphanumeric code used for online transfers, while MICR is a 9-digit numeric code printed on cheques and used by cheque-clearing machines. Both identify the Kasba Kotla branch but serve different purposes.
